DESCRIPTION:Queer Death Salon is a virtual community space for all 2SLGBTQIA+ people to come together to discuss death\, dying and grief. It is a facilitated drop-in discussion space\, with the purpose of building connection\, skill\, and resources for 2SLGBTQIA+ people navigating end of life in our personal lives and in our communities. \n\n\n\nMedical interventions\, hypersensitivities\, decreased capacity for verbal communication\, and pain can all contribute to a sense of isolation for both the dying and those attending to them. A dying person may experience an aversion to touch\, cognitive changes\, unclear capacity for consent\, and even expressions of unexpected sexuality. The challenge of a partner or family member’s transition into a caregiving role often goes unacknowledged. \n\n\n\nWith tenderness and curiosity\, we will reflect on our own experience\, boundaries and values\, and build more skill to confidently navigate the challenges of intimacy at the end of life\, so that we can receive its gifts. \n\n\n\nVanessa Carlisle\, PhD (they/them) is a graduate of the Going With Grace death doula training program and certified by the National End of Life Doula Association. Vanessa brings experience with in-home caregiving\, DWD/EOLD\, navigating hospital and hospice services\, dementia care\, and the complex family/community dynamics that arise with deaths due to violence\, suicide\, and overdose.

DESCRIPTION:Please join us for an exciting public talk and workshop with Sarah Lamble\, Professor of Criminology and Queer Theory (Birkbeck College\, UCL) as they launch their book\, Unsafe: The Carceral Roots of the Anti-Trans Backlash\, newly published (currently 20% off) with Haymarket Books. \n\n\n\nSaturday 12 September3-5:30pmParlour RoomCarleton Dominion Chalmers Centre290 Lisgar Street\, Ottawa \n\n\n\nRegister through the link below! \n\n\n\nABOUT THE BOOKThe twenty-first century “gender wars” have been driven by a powerful and seductive narrative: that safety can be secured through exclusion\, surveillance\, and the policing of difference. These punitive logics have gained momentum across the political spectrum\, fueling an anti-trans backlash and distorting the meaning of safety itself. \n\n\n\nUnsafe is a clear-eyed and decisive challenge to the toxic ideas at the heart of this backlash. With patient rigour\, Lamble exposes how carceral approaches to safety fail to address root causes of harm\, ultimately deepening social divisions and legitimising new forms of violence and control. \n\n\n\nABOUT THE AUTHORLamble is a community organizer and Professor of Criminology and Queer Theory at Birkbeck\, University of London. Their work explores questions of gender\, sexuality\, and justice with a focus on feminist and abolitionist alternatives to prisons\, police\, and punishment. DESCRIPTION:Courtney Montour\, Director / Jason Brennan\, Producer • 1 hour 28 minutes • 2025 • Canada • English with French Subtitles \n\n\n\nUniting from across continents to bring representation to the sport they love\, Indigenous Rising laces up their skates to claim their space on the roller derby track. \n\n\n\nIndigenous Rising is the first team in roller derby history to break the barriers of representing a single country at the Roller Derby World Cup – igniting a movement that pulsates throughout the sport and within each other. Rising Through the Fray follows the team as it welcomes a new generation of players determined to change the face of roller derby—an inclusive\, female-empowering sport still lacking diversity. \n\n\n\nWith a compassionate and candid lens\, filmmaker Courtney Montour weaves energetic on-track game play with tender moments in teammates’ daily lives as skaters from over 30 Indigenous Nations navigate and learn each other’s play styles at tournaments and find strength within each other to compete and skate onto the track with pride. \n\n\n\nIntimate portraits of teammates Sour Cherry\, Krispy and Hawaiian Blaze reveal stories of displacement and disconnection from their culture and identities and the journey of finding belonging within team Indigenous Rising. \n\n\n\nRising Through the Fray offers a poignant exploration of resiliency\, healing and reconnection of a roller derby family with a bond that goes beyond sport.
